Mason County has 109 registered underground storage tank facilities in the national snapshot — gas stations, fleet yards, and other regulated fuel sites — holding 62 tanks in service and 270 tanks that have been closed or removed, plus 5 temporarily out of service. Over the life of the program, 31 fuel releases were reported here; 29 (94% of records) were investigated and closed with No Further Action, and 2 of those cleanup cases were still open when the snapshot was compiled.

That works out to 22.8 tanks in service per 10,000 residents, above the West Virginia average of 19.9 per 10,000. Countywide numbers are context, not a verdict on any parcel — tank risk is hyper-local, falling off within a few hundred feet.
